HEADLIGHT SWITCH AND HALO LIGHT SWITCH

Automatic Headlights/Parking
Lights/Headlights

• Rotate the headlight switch, located on

the instrument panel to the left of the
steering wheel, to the first detent for
parking lights

and to the second

detent for headlights

.

• With the parking lights or low beam

headlights on, push the headlight switch
once for fog lights.

• Rotate the headlight switch to “AUTO”

for AUTO headlights.

• When set to AUTO, the system automatically turns the headlights on or off based on

ambient light levels.

SmartBeams™

• This system automatically controls the use of the headlight high beams. Refer to

Programmable Features in Electronics for further details.

Instrument Panel Dimmer

• Rotate the dimmer control to the extreme bottom position to fully dim the instrument

panel lights and prevent the interior lights from illuminating when a door is opened.

• Rotate the dimmer control up to increase the brightness of the instrument panel when the

parking lights or headlights are on.

• Rotate the dimmer control up to the next detent position to fully brighten the odometer

and radio when the parking lights or headlights are on. Refer to your Media Center/Radio
User Manual on the DVD for display dimming.

• Rotate the dimmer control up to the last detent position to turn on the interior lighting.

Overhead (Halo) Light

• To activate the Halo lights, rotate the Halo switch control upward or downward to increase

or decrease the lighting.
